It seems that when I built MetaFont I included X11 window support.  The
dvips program will automagically run MetaFont when it discovers that
a specific magnification of a font is missing.  This is wonderful, except
that I do not want or need to see MetaFont building each character.  Is
there a way to tell MetaFont to not use X11?  Would just unsetting the
DISPLAY environment variable do the trick?
